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Channeling, by its nature, involves a wide and disparate range of disciplines. Crystal preparation, material science, accelerator physics, sophisticated theoretical analysis and, of course, channeling itself all must work in concert in a research program. In spite of the gulfs separating some of these activities, researchers have drawn together over the last decade to carry out remarkable experiments in relativistic channeling and channeling radiation. Several informal workshops on high-energy channeling have been held over ~he years at Aarhus and Fermilab. However, with the vigorous progress in the field in the last several years it became clear that a more formal, comprehensive workshop was needed along with a book that covered the whole spectrum of the new developments, probed the future, and also laid out some of the foundations of the subject. Book excerpt: The twelfth-century French poet Chrétien de Troyes is a major figure in European literature. His courtly romances fathered the Arthurian tradition and influenced countless other poets in England as well as on the continent. Yet because of the difficulty of capturing his swift-moving style in translation, English-speaking audiences are largely unfamiliar with the pleasures of reading his poems. Now, for the first time, an experienced translator of medieval verse who is himself a poet provides a translation of Chrétien’s major poem, Yvain, in verse that fully and satisfyingly captures the movement, the sense, and the spirit of the Old French original. Yvain is a courtly romance with a moral tenor; it is ironic and sometimes bawdy; the poetry is crisp and vivid. In addition, the psychological and the socio-historical perceptions of the poem are of profound literary and historical importance, for it evokes the emotions and the values of a flourishing, vibrant medieval past.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In 1903 Fredholm published his famous paper on integral equations. Since then linear integral operators have become an important tool in many areas, including the theory of Fourier series and Fourier integrals, approximation theory and summability theory, and the theory of integral and differential equations. As regards the latter, applications were soon extended beyond linear operators. In approximation theory, however, applications were limited to linear operators mainly by the fact that the notion of singularity of an integral operator was closely connected with its linearity. This book represents the first attempt at a comprehensive treatment of approximation theory by means of nonlinear integral operators in function spaces. In particular, the fundamental notions of approximate identity for kernels of nonlinear operators and a general concept of modulus of continuity are developed in order to obtain consistent approximation results. Applications to nonlinear summability, nonlinear integral equations and nonlinear sampling theory are given. In particular, the study of nonlinear sampling operators is important since the results permit the reconstruction of several classes of signals. In a wider context, the material of this book represents a starting point for new areas of research in nonlinear analysis. For this reason the text is written in a style accessible not only to researchers but to advanced students as well.

Book excerpt: The influence and impact of digital images on modern society, science, technology and art are tremendous. Image processing has become such a critical component in contemporary science and technology that many tasks would not be attempted without it. It is a truly interdisciplinary subject that draws from synergistic developments involving many disciplines and is used in medical imaging, microscopy, astronomy, computer vision, geology and many other fields. With a few exceptions, the topics of optical information processing and digital information processing are usually covered in different books, written by experts in one field or the other. It is rare that the two topics are both covered in the same volume. This book is an exception to this trend, and is notable in several different aspects, but especially in its breadth of coverage of both topics. It seems very appropriate to have both general topics covered in the same book, for optical processing systems (defined broadly) commonly include digital systems to drive the optical system and to post-process the data (example: adaptive-optic systems), while digital processing systems most commonly operate on data that has been gathered by an optical system. As a consequence, sophisticated image-gathering and handling systems today include both types of technology, a merger that grows more complete as time progresses. Indeed, even consumer-oriented devices such as digital cameras are sophisticated systems with optical and digital parts.
